From 8a834ea2ee25cf6f426a447ae5714624b1586d64 Mon Sep 17 00:00:00 2001
From: Fioren <102145692+FiorenMas@users.noreply.github.com>
Date: Wed, 13 Mar 2024 09:36:19 +0700
Subject: [PATCH] added more beta apps, fix bug
---
.github/workflows/manual-patch.yml | 11 +++-
README.md | 42 ++++++++++----
src/build/Revanced-3.sh | 2 +-
.../{Revanced-Beta.sh => Revanced-Beta-1.sh} | 0
src/build/Revanced-Beta-2.sh | 58 +++++++++++++++++++
src/build/Revanced-Beta-3.sh | 49 ++++++++++++++++
src/patches/messenger/exclude-patches | 2 +-
7 files changed, 150 insertions(+), 14 deletions(-)
rename src/build/{Revanced-Beta.sh => Revanced-Beta-1.sh} (100%)
create mode 100644 src/build/Revanced-Beta-2.sh
create mode 100644 src/build/Revanced-Beta-3.sh
diff --git a/.github/workflows/manual-patch.yml b/.github/workflows/manual-patch.yml
index 07c9434..83f53df 100644
--- a/.github/workflows/manual-patch.yml
+++ b/.github/workflows/manual-patch.yml
@@ -68,6 +68,15 @@ jobs:
name: Patch Revanced Beta
if: ${{ github.event.inputs.org == 'Revanced Beta' || github.event.inputs.org == 'All' || inputs.org == 'Revanced Beta' }}
runs-on: ubuntu-latest
+ strategy:
+ matrix:
+ Include:
+ - org: "Revanced-Beta"
+ run: "1"
+ - org: "Revanced-Beta"
+ run: "2"
+ - org: "Revanced-Beta"
+ run: "3"
steps:
- name: Checkout
uses: actions/checkout@v4.1.1
@@ -79,7 +88,7 @@ jobs:
- name: Patch apk
id: patch-rvb
if: steps.check-gh-rvb.outputs.internet_error == '0'
- run: bash src/build/Revanced-Beta.sh
+ run: bash src/build/Revanced-Beta-${{ matrix.Include.run }}.sh
- name: Releasing APK files
if: steps.check-gh-rvb.outputs.internet_error == '0'
uses: ./.github/actions/release
diff --git a/README.md b/README.md
index 6eee1ed..6a43ffb 100644
--- a/README.md
+++ b/README.md
@@ -6,7 +6,7 @@ They are open-source scripts for patching various apps like YouTube, YouTube Mus
[](https://github.com/FiorenMas/View-Counter)
-
+
[](https://t.me/fioren374)
@@ -168,7 +168,9 @@ Download
### Revanced:
-[Arm64-v8a & Android 11+](https://github.com/FiorenMas/Revanced-And-Revanced-Extended-Non-Root/releases/download/all/facebook-arm64-v8a-revanced.apk)
+| Stable version | Beta version |
+| ---------------------------------------------------------------------------------------------------------------------------------------------------- | ---------------------------------------------------------------------------------------------------------------------------------------------------------- |
+|[Arm64-v8a & Android 11+](https://github.com/FiorenMas/Revanced-And-Revanced-Extended-Non-Root/releases/download/all/facebook-arm64-v8a-revanced.apk) | [Arm64-v8a & Android 11+](https://github.com/FiorenMas/Revanced-And-Revanced-Extended-Non-Root/releases/download/all/facebook-arm64-v8a-beta-revanced.apk) |
---
@@ -176,7 +178,9 @@ Download
### Revanced:
-[All Architectures](https://github.com/FiorenMas/Revanced-And-Revanced-Extended-Non-Root/releases/download/all/twitter-revanced.apk)
+| Stable version | Beta version |
+| ------------------------------------------------------------------------------------------------------------------------------------ | ----------------------------------------------------------------------------------------------------------------------------------------- |
+| [All Architectures](https://github.com/FiorenMas/Revanced-And-Revanced-Extended-Non-Root/releases/download/all/twitter-revanced.apk) | [All Architectures](https://github.com/FiorenMas/Revanced-And-Revanced-Extended-Non-Root/releases/download/all/twitter-beta-revanced.apk) |
---
@@ -184,7 +188,9 @@ Download
### Revanced:
-[Arm64-v8a](https://github.com/FiorenMas/Revanced-And-Revanced-Extended-Non-Root/releases/download/all/instagram-arm64-v8a-revanced.apk)
+| Stable version | Beta version |
+| ---------------------------------------------------------------------------------------------------------------------------------------- | --------------------------------------------------------------------------------------------------------------------------------------------- |
+| [Arm64-v8a](https://github.com/FiorenMas/Revanced-And-Revanced-Extended-Non-Root/releases/download/all/instagram-arm64-v8a-revanced.apk) | [Arm64-v8a](https://github.com/FiorenMas/Revanced-And-Revanced-Extended-Non-Root/releases/download/all/instagram-arm64-v8a-beta-revanced.apk) |
---
@@ -192,7 +198,9 @@ Download
### Revanced:
-[Arm64-v8a](https://github.com/FiorenMas/Revanced-And-Revanced-Extended-Non-Root/releases/download/all/messenger-arm64-v8a-revanced.apk)
+| Stable version | Beta version |
+| ---------------------------------------------------------------------------------------------------------------------------------------- | --------------------------------------------------------------------------------------------------------------------------------------------- |
+| [Arm64-v8a](https://github.com/FiorenMas/Revanced-And-Revanced-Extended-Non-Root/releases/download/all/messenger-arm64-v8a-revanced.apk) | [Arm64-v8a](https://github.com/FiorenMas/Revanced-And-Revanced-Extended-Non-Root/releases/download/all/messenger-arm64-v8a-beta-revanced.apk) |
---
@@ -200,7 +208,9 @@ Download
### Revanced:
-[All Architectures](https://github.com/FiorenMas/Revanced-And-Revanced-Extended-Non-Root/releases/download/all/tiktok-revanced.apk)
+| Stable version | Beta version |
+| ----------------------------------------------------------------------------------------------------------------------------------- | ---------------------------------------------------------------------------------------------------------------------------------------- |
+| [All Architectures](https://github.com/FiorenMas/Revanced-And-Revanced-Extended-Non-Root/releases/download/all/tiktok-revanced.apk) | [All Architectures](https://github.com/FiorenMas/Revanced-And-Revanced-Extended-Non-Root/releases/download/all/tiktok-beta-revanced.apk) |
---
@@ -208,7 +218,9 @@ Download
### Revanced:
-[All Architectures](https://github.com/FiorenMas/Revanced-And-Revanced-Extended-Non-Root/releases/download/all/twitch-revanced.apk)
+| Stable version | Beta version |
+| ----------------------------------------------------------------------------------------------------------------------------------- | ---------------------------------------------------------------------------------------------------------------------------------------- |
+| [All Architectures](https://github.com/FiorenMas/Revanced-And-Revanced-Extended-Non-Root/releases/download/all/twitch-revanced.apk) | [All Architectures](https://github.com/FiorenMas/Revanced-And-Revanced-Extended-Non-Root/releases/download/all/twitch-beta-revanced.apk) |
---
@@ -216,7 +228,9 @@ Download
### Revanced:
-[All Architectures](https://github.com/FiorenMas/Revanced-And-Revanced-Extended-Non-Root/releases/download/all/reddit-revanced.apk)
+| Stable version | Beta version |
+| ----------------------------------------------------------------------------------------------------------------------------------- | ---------------------------------------------------------------------------------------------------------------------------------------- |
+| [All Architectures](https://github.com/FiorenMas/Revanced-And-Revanced-Extended-Non-Root/releases/download/all/reddit-revanced.apk) | [All Architectures](https://github.com/FiorenMas/Revanced-And-Revanced-Extended-Non-Root/releases/download/all/reddit-beta-revanced.apk) |
### ReX:
@@ -232,7 +246,9 @@ Download
### Revanced:
-[All Architectures](https://github.com/FiorenMas/Revanced-And-Revanced-Extended-Non-Root/releases/download/all/lightroom-revanced.apk)
+| Stable version | Beta version |
+| -------------------------------------------------------------------------------------------------------------------------------------- | ------------------------------------------------------------------------------------------------------------------------------------------- |
+| [All Architectures](https://github.com/FiorenMas/Revanced-And-Revanced-Extended-Non-Root/releases/download/all/lightroom-revanced.apk) | [All Architectures](https://github.com/FiorenMas/Revanced-And-Revanced-Extended-Non-Root/releases/download/all/lightroom-beta-revanced.apk) |
---
@@ -240,7 +256,9 @@ Download
### Revanced:
-[All Architectures](https://github.com/FiorenMas/Revanced-And-Revanced-Extended-Non-Root/releases/download/all/tumblr-revanced.apk)
+| Stable version | Beta version |
+| ----------------------------------------------------------------------------------------------------------------------------------- | ---------------------------------------------------------------------------------------------------------------------------------------- |
+| [All Architectures](https://github.com/FiorenMas/Revanced-And-Revanced-Extended-Non-Root/releases/download/all/tumblr-revanced.apk) | [All Architectures](https://github.com/FiorenMas/Revanced-And-Revanced-Extended-Non-Root/releases/download/all/tumblr-beta-revanced.apk) |
---
@@ -248,7 +266,9 @@ Download
### Revanced:
-[All Architectures](https://github.com/FiorenMas/Revanced-And-Revanced-Extended-Non-Root/releases/download/all/pixiv-revanced.apk)
+| Stable version | Beta version |
+| ---------------------------------------------------------------------------------------------------------------------------------- | --------------------------------------------------------------------------------------------------------------------------------------- |
+| [All Architectures](https://github.com/FiorenMas/Revanced-And-Revanced-Extended-Non-Root/releases/download/all/pixiv-revanced.apk) | [All Architectures](https://github.com/FiorenMas/Revanced-And-Revanced-Extended-Non-Root/releases/download/all/pixiv-beta-revanced.apk) |
---
diff --git a/src/build/Revanced-3.sh b/src/build/Revanced-3.sh
index 7b57e7b..3624e2e 100644
--- a/src/build/Revanced-3.sh
+++ b/src/build/Revanced-3.sh
@@ -12,7 +12,7 @@ dl_gh "revanced-patches revanced-cli revanced-integrations" "revanced" "latest"
# Patch Facebook:
# Arm64-v8a
get_patches_key "facebook"
-get_apk "facebook-arm64-v8a" "facebook" "facebook-2/facebook/facebook" "arm64-v8a" "nodpi" "Android 11+"
+get_apk "facebook-arm64-v8a" "facebook" "facebook-2/facebook/facebook" "arm64-v8a" "" "Android 11+"
patch "facebook-arm64-v8a" "revanced"
#################################################
diff --git a/src/build/Revanced-Beta.sh b/src/build/Revanced-Beta-1.sh
similarity index 100%
rename from src/build/Revanced-Beta.sh
rename to src/build/Revanced-Beta-1.sh
diff --git a/src/build/Revanced-Beta-2.sh b/src/build/Revanced-Beta-2.sh
new file mode 100644
index 0000000..c37b273
--- /dev/null
+++ b/src/build/Revanced-Beta-2.sh
@@ -0,0 +1,58 @@
+#!/bin/bash
+# Revanced build
+source ./src/build/utils.sh
+
+#################################################
+
+# Download requirements
+dl_gh "revanced-patches revanced-integrations" "revanced" "prerelease"
+dl_gh "revanced-cli" "revanced" "latest"
+
+#################################################
+
+# Patch Instagram:
+# Arm64-v8a
+get_patches_key "instagram"
+#get_ver "Hide timeline ads" "com.instagram.android"
+get_apk "instagram-arm64-v8a-beta" "instagram-instagram" "instagram/instagram-instagram/instagram-instagram" "arm64-v8a" "nodpi"
+patch "instagram-arm64-v8a-beta" "revanced"
+
+#################################################
+
+# Patch Messenger:
+# Arm64-v8a
+get_patches_key "messenger"
+get_apk "messenger-arm64-v8a-beta" "messenger" "facebook-2/messenger/messenger" "arm64-v8a" "nodpi"
+patch "messenger-arm64-v8a-beta" "revanced"
+
+#################################################
+
+# Patch Twitter:
+get_patches_key "twitter"
+get_apk "twitter-beta" "twitter" "x-corp/twitter/twitter"
+patch "twitter-beta" "revanced"
+
+#################################################
+
+# Patch Twitch:
+get_patches_key "twitch"
+get_ver "Block audio ads" "tv.twitch.android.app"
+get_apk "twitch-beta" "twitch" "twitch-interactive-inc/twitch/twitch"
+patch "twitch-beta" "revanced"
+
+#################################################
+
+# Patch Reddit:
+get_patches_key "reddit"
+get_apk "reddit-beta" "reddit" "redditinc/reddit/reddit"
+patch "reddit-beta" "revanced"
+
+#################################################
+
+# Patch Tiktok:
+get_patches_key "tiktok"
+get_ver "Feed filter" "com.ss.android.ugc.trill"
+get_apk "tiktok-beta" "tik-tok" "tiktok-pte-ltd/tik-tok/tik-tok"
+patch "tiktok-beta" "revanced"
+
+#################################################
diff --git a/src/build/Revanced-Beta-3.sh b/src/build/Revanced-Beta-3.sh
new file mode 100644
index 0000000..a17aa6e
--- /dev/null
+++ b/src/build/Revanced-Beta-3.sh
@@ -0,0 +1,49 @@
+#!/bin/bash
+# Revanced build
+source ./src/build/utils.sh
+
+#################################################
+
+# Download requirements
+dl_gh "revanced-patches revanced-integrations" "revanced" "prerelease"
+dl_gh "revanced-cli" "revanced" "latest"
+
+#################################################
+
+# Patch Facebook:
+# Arm64-v8a
+get_patches_key "facebook"
+get_apk "facebook-arm64-v8a-beta" "facebook" "facebook-2/facebook/facebook" "arm64-v8a" "" "Android 11+"
+patch "facebook-arm64-v8a-beta" "revanced"
+
+#################################################
+
+# Patch Pixiv:
+get_patches_key "pixiv"
+get_apk "pixiv-beta" "pixiv" "pixiv-inc/pixiv/pixiv"
+patch "pixiv-beta" "revanced"
+
+#################################################
+
+# Patch Lightroom:
+get_patches_key "lightroom"
+get_apk "lightroom-beta" "lightroom" "adobe/lightroom/lightroom" "arm64-v8a"
+patch "lightroom-beta" "revanced"
+
+#################################################
+
+# Patch Windy:
+get_patches_key "windy"
+version="34.0.2"
+get_apk "windy" "windy-wind-weather-forecast" "windy-weather-world-inc/windy-wind-weather-forecast/windy-wind-weather-forecast"
+patch "windy" "revanced"
+
+#################################################
+
+# Patch Tumblr:
+get_patches_key "tumblr"
+version="33.2.0.110"
+get_apk "tumblr-beta" "tumblr" "tumblr-inc/tumblr/tumblr"
+patch "tumblr-beta" "revanced"
+
+#################################################
diff --git a/src/patches/messenger/exclude-patches b/src/patches/messenger/exclude-patches
index f2a00c8..1e38421 100644
--- a/src/patches/messenger/exclude-patches
+++ b/src/patches/messenger/exclude-patches
@@ -1 +1 @@
-disable-switching-emoji-to-sticker-in-message-input-field
+Disable switching emoji to sticker
\ No newline at end of file